"Brisbane Aquatic Centre is the premier aquatic facility in Queensland with a focus on delivering high performance training and hosting International, National and State events.

The Brisbane Aquatic Centre is part of the Sleeman Sports Complex (SSC) precinct.  SSC is a high performance and community venue of Stadiums Queensland (SQ) with the vision of “Preparing the heroes of today, inspiring the stars of tomorrow”. SSC will be front and centre at the 2032 Olympics and Paralympics, hosting Track Cycling and BMX, Gymnastics, Diving, Artistic Swimming, Water polo preliminaries and Wheelchair Basketball.

The organisation:

SQ is charged with the management of major sports facilities that are declared under Queensland Government regulation as being venues having the capacity to stage national or international sports events, recreational or entertainment experiences. SQ’s portfolio of venues include Suncorp Stadium, The Gabba, Sleeman Sports Complex, Brisbane Entertainment Centre, Queensland Sport and Athletics Centre, Queensland Country Bank Stadium, Cbus Super Stadium, Queensland Tennis Centre, and People First Stadium
